Transaction 918c59fffc684d260634e50bc307c093a3f67365b936f2636e4097d6432e6f7e
1 Input
2 Outputs
- 918c59fffc684d260634e50bc307c093a3f67365b936f2636e4097d6432e6f7e:0
- 918c59fffc684d260634e50bc307c093a3f67365b936f2636e4097d6432e6f7e:1
value 1977812
address 1JcaWeHem3rHu73Ne94gzJRmKMmKHxxNAD
value 3153860
address 3FuK2nRDqoKDRwjDS99Tqe5U1BXo2KMHEU